Technologies

Microwave

Microwave links provide high-capacity, long-distance connectivity where fibre is unavailable or impractical. With engineered path diversity and carrier-grade equipment, microwave delivers reliable transport for mission-critical operations across remote or complex terrain. It is ideal for backhaul, redundancy, and extending network reach without costly civil works.

IP Networks

IP networks form the foundational layer of digital communication, enabling devices, applications and systems to exchange data efficiently across sites. Designed for scalability and flexibility, IP networks support a wide range of operational technologies, from sensors to enterprise systems. Our designs prioritise security, availability and seamless integration with broader infrastructure.

Fibre Transport (DWDM, GPON)

Fibre transport delivers the highest levels of bandwidth, resilience and performance for organisations moving large volumes of data across multiple locations. DWDM enables multi-channel, long-haul transport over a single fibre pair, while GPON provides efficient last-mile distribution. Together, these technologies create a future-ready backbone for high-speed, latency-sensitive applications.

IP/MPLS

IP/MPLS networks provide deterministic, traffic-engineered routing that ensures performance for time-critical services. MPLS enables segmentation, prioritisation and secure transport across shared infrastructure, making it ideal for complex, multi-service environments. This architecture underpins highly reliable, scalable and predictable network operations.

Ethernet

Ethernet delivers flexible, standards-based connectivity across access, aggregation and distribution layers. It supports a broad mix of devices and applications, enabling straightforward integration and rapid deployment. With options for ruggedised and industrial environments, Ethernet remains a versatile and cost-effective building block for fixed infrastructure networks.

Public Address Systems

Public address systems enable clear, consistent audio communication across operational sites, transport hubs and industrial environments. Integrated with core networks, these systems support announcements, alarms, safety messaging and operational coordination. We design PA systems for high intelligibility, reliability and seamless control across distributed locations.

Camp Entertainment Networks

Camp entertainment networks provide workers with access to TV, streaming, internet and communication services across remote accommodation villages. These networks enhance on-site wellbeing and retention while integrating securely with operational infrastructure. Designed for reliability and ease of management, they ensure consistent service delivery regardless of location.
